Originally Posted by Nathael
I have been selected and I am now planning my trip to dublin. Unfortunately the earliest flight in the morning makes me arrive at 7:30 am at the airport which I guess is a bit late to be at the meeting point at 8:00. Do you have some tips to find a cheap hotel near the airport for me to arrive the previous night.

also can someone explains to me what we are going to attend during the day. Like what type of exercise or interviews we are going to do. Thank you a lot

last year, about 4 days after invites went out , I was sent the hotel preferential rates for those that need to stay the night before. ( I had same issue of flight arriving at 7am on the day) the discount was reasonable and saved about £50 on booking direct. Just book on-site in the cheapest room possible.

last year it was intro by Aer lingus.
Split into groups if 5 or 6 and complete the group task
one to one personal interview that lasted 5 mins.
break for a bit then the first ones being let go are told there and then they aren’t progressing and can go home. Bit tough if return flight home is booked for 7pm! Long wait indeed.
The afternoon is a panel interview.

this year could well be different format though. Who knows.
